Teresa Jordan studied printmaking most recently with Wim De Voss and Adele Outridge at Brisbane’s Studio West End and has also learned much from workshops presented by fellow Impress members, Jennifer Sanzaro-Nishimura and Carolyn McKenzie Craig.
Although now working mainly with collagraphs, Teresa worked extensively with screen-printing in the 1980s and 90s. As part of the Inkahoots poster collective she facilitated several community screen-printing and design projects.
Teresa is an experienced art teacher and has developed a wide range of approaches to art making. She regularly exhibits paintings and drawings in artist run spaces in Brisbane. Her work is represented in the collections of the Australian National Gallery, Queensland Art Gallery, Griffith University Art Collection and in private collections in Australia and the US.
